Position Summary
This position is responsible for supporting the administration of various EHS programs and initiatives. This includes overseeing Contractor Safety programs, managing Safe Work Permits, and supporting the training of programs such as confined space entry, lockout tagout, and work at height. This supplemental role ensures compliance with environmental, safety, medical surveillance, and sustainability laws and regulations at the federal, state, and local levels. The position will also involve participation in self-assessments, inspections, GEMBAs, hazard assessments, and audits. Overall, this position plays a crucial role in supporting the site EHS team and promoting a safe and compliant work environment.
